Jiffy Lube Raleigh NC
Add Website
Close
Jiffy Lube
Be first to review 5929 Glenwood Ave,Raleigh NC 27612-6223 Phone Number: (919) 781-1116
Jiffy Lube Store Hours
Hours may fluctuate
Post a review
Jiffy Lube Nearby
Locations Closest to You miles-
Jiffy Lube - Raleigh 5930 GLENWOOD AVE0.13
-
Jiffy Lube - Raleigh 8207 CREEDMOOR RD3.35
-
Jiffy Lube - Raleigh 220 NEWTON RD3.48